Title: Electro-optical Response of the In-plane Switching Liquid Crystal Device Fabricated Using Two-easy-axes Substrate
Authors: Huang, Chi-Yen;Hsieh, Chia-Ting;Tian, Jing-Rui

Abstract: We investigate the electro-optical response of an in-plane switching (IPS) liquid crystal (LC) device, which is fabricated using the two-easy-axes substrate. The two-easy-axes substrate is fabricated by slightly rubbing the substrate in two different directions. Experimental results indicate that the IPS LC device fabricated using the two-easy-axes substrate has a lower threshold voltage and a faster response time than the traditional IPS LC device, which is fabricated using the unidirectionally rubbed substrate. The weak anchoring condition and the anchoring strengths in two different rubbing directions on the substrate contribute to the fast electro-optical response of the IPS LC device.
